Amsterdam City Centre

Amsterdam's artistic Amsterdam City Centre neighborhood is loved for its biking trails and boating, and visitors often enjoy its varied attractions such as Dam Square and Nieuwmarkt Square.

Jordaan

Upscale modern art galleries thrive in this historic area, while markets bustle at Noordermarkt, Westerstraat, and Lindengracht. Explore tranquil gardens and hidden courtyards (hofjes), or visit the Anne Frank House nearby.

Museum Quarter

In the heart of Amsterdam-Zuid, Museumkwartier boasts major museums like Rijksmuseum, Stedelijk Museum, and Van Gogh Museum. Enjoy concerts at Concertgebouw, unwind in Vondelpark, and access tram lines 2, 3, 5, 12, 16, and 24.

Canal Ring

Discover Amsterdam's Grachtengordel, where 17th-century canal homes and small bridges adorn the Singel, Herengracht, Keizersgracht, and Prinsengracht canals. Visit the Anne Frank House and other nearby museums for a rich cultural experience.

What is the best time to stay in a business hotel in Amsterdam?
If you’re looking for the warmest weather, organize your work trip for August. The temperatures are around 59ºF (15ºC) to 72ºF (22ºC) then. January sees the coolest temperatures between 36ºF (2ºC) and 41ºF (5ºC). For smaller crowds and potentially cheaper business hotels in Amsterdam, visit in January when it’s quieter.
